Transaction 586182158ffb815466642520c74f11008feae2b806cc04ad28bf3b058b29bafe

2 Input
2 Outputs
  • 586182158ffb815466642520c74f11008feae2b806cc04ad28bf3b058b29bafe:0
  • value  1000726
    address  2N9Uokb4YCSoGqZXvKQVZDJTMmaAHMP4VWE
  • 586182158ffb815466642520c74f11008feae2b806cc04ad28bf3b058b29bafe:1
  • value  20092
    address  2NFexpDUQXbM1epuHTgCzpbmVLQv1kibJwr